Every programme at the Academy is founded on a single principle: clinical competence is developed through supervised practice on authentic cases.
Our approach
A Rigorous Academic Approach
Our programmes combine focused theoretical instruction with substantial supervised practice, allowing participants to plan, perform and review procedures until competence is achieved.
Programmes range from short intensive courses to multi-month clinical tracks, all delivered in English.
Programme Structure
The Components of Study
Pre-course learning
Structured reading and case material before you arrive.
Hands-on sessions
Supervised practice on models and, where appropriate, live clinics.
Case review
Case-based discussions examine diagnosis, treatment planning, clinical decisions and outcomes from different perspectives.
Assessment
Practical evaluation aligned to CPD/CE frameworks.
Mentorship
Direct access to faculty throughout the programme.
Alumni network
Continued connection and learning after you finish.
